Derek K. Burch is a firmly rooted Oklahoman, but his reputation as a trial lawyer has taken him to courts across the country. Oftentimes, his own cases take him to other jurisdictions, but frequently he is called upon by lawyers elsewhere to assist them in their own local cases.. After receiving his J.D. from the Oklahoma City University School of Law in December, 1988, Burch began his legal career working for two law firms that handled insurance defense and commercial work, but it wasn’t the kind of law that he wanted to practice. Noted Oklahoma City plaintiff’s attorney Ed Abel gave Burch the chance to join his firm and handle personal-injury cases and Burch found what he was looking for. Burch’s old law-school friend, Kelly A. George, then also joined the Abel firm and they worked together there for several years before deciding to create their own firm, launching Burch & George in 1997.

DeeAnn L. Germany joined the firm of Burch & George in 1998 immediately after receiving her J.D. from the University of Oklahoma College of Law and has spent her entire legal career with this firm. In 2011, she became a partner and the firm changed its name to Burch, George & Germany.. Her practice has maintained its same essential focus over the years: solely plaintiff’s work, representing individuals in cases involving medical-device and products liability, motor-vehicle accidents, catastrophic injury, medical malpractice, and breaches of contracts.. In 2007, Germany recorded a $1,025,000 verdict against an orthopedic medical-device manufacturer after a femoral stem broke in a hip replacement for her client.. Early in her career, Germany and future law partner Derek K. Burchtried a slip-and-fall case that resulted in a verdict of more than $1 million for a young man who was severely and permanently injured.. She also recently negotiated a just settlement on behalf of the family of a three-year-old girl who was killed in an accident with a tractor-trailer that jackknifed when its driver was going too fast on a two-lane country road.. In representing injured people and their families, Germany finds that compassion is often in short supply with defendant companies.

Kelly A. George grew up intending to remain on his family’s farm in southwestern Oklahoma and follow in his father’s and grandfather’s footsteps.. But when he went away to attend Oklahoma Christian University in the early 1980s because his parents insisted on him obtaining a college degree, the farming economy sharply declined and became much less appealing. So when he received his B.S. degree in American Studies in 1985, George opted for an alternative career path. He decided to become a lawyer instead of a farmer, attending Oklahoma City University Law School and the University of Oklahoma College of Law, receiving his J.D. in 1989.. George has never doubted that decision because he’s found that he enjoys the practice of law as much as he does agriculture and has compiled a solid career as a plaintiff’s lawyer.. After receiving his J.D., he launched his legal career working at an established general-practice firm, mostly defending businesses and insurance companies. One day a case came his way in which the opposing counsel was an old law-school friend, Derek K. Burch, who was practicing with well-known plaintiff’s attorney Ed Abel. George settled that case with his former classmate—and became convinced he wanted to cross over to the plaintiff side. George got hired at the firm where Burch worked, and he and Burch began handling many cases together.. After several years, the two friends decided they wanted to launch their own practice, and in 1997, the law firm of Burch & George was born.. The two founding partners have remained true to their goal of focusing solely on plaintiff’s cases. In his own practice, George has achieved numerous significant outcomes, including a number of large verdicts and seven-figure settlements.. One of those notable cases involved catastrophic injuries suffered by the operator of an excavating machine who struck a gas line that exploded, burning him badly. The defendant utility company had neglected to properly identify the location of the gas line and finally agreed to settle the case for seven figures.
